    I'm heading off to Seattle for the upcoming weekend. I know the Pacific Northwest is a mecca of sorts for craft beer. Anybody have any suggestions for what I should look for or ask for while I'm out there? I know about Redhook and Ranier. I'm particularing interested in microbrew lagers and Pilsners. Any inside information or suggestions are appreciated...

    It's out of Eugene, Oregon, but I always loved Ninkasi beers, especially Believer Double Red.

    For a Seattle brewpub, I always enjoyed Elysian Brewing Company. Got a couple locations, including one near Safeco.
